Location & Nearby Attractions
Nestled in the heart of Grundarfjordur, Kirkjufell Guesthouse is perfectly positioned for exploring the wonders of West Iceland. Just a short distance away, the iconic Kirkjufell Mountain, often called "the most photographed mountain in Iceland," awaits your visit. The nearby Kirkjufellsfoss Waterfall offers a picturesque backdrop for memorable photos.
Guests can also enjoy easy access to the Snaefellsjokull National Park, known for its stunning glacier and diverse hiking trails. The charming village of Olafsvik, with its quaint shops and local eateries, is within reach, offering a taste of authentic Icelandic culture and cuisine.
